What are some common challenges faced by contract Navy software engineers when working on defense projects?

Contract Navy Software Engineers often encounter unique challenges such as navigating strict security protocols, adapting to rapidly changing project requirements, and integrating new software with legacy naval systems. Collaboration with multidisciplinary teams—including military personnel and civilian contractors—requires clear communication and flexibility. Successfully managing these challenges not only ensures project success but also builds valuable experience for advancing to more senior or specialized defense engineering roles.

What is a contract Navy software engineer?

Contract Navy Software Engineers are professionals who work on a contractual basis to develop, maintain, and improve software systems used by the Navy. They are typically employed by private companies that have contracts with the Navy, rather than being enlisted military personnel. Their work can include creating embedded systems, cybersecurity solutions, data analysis platforms, or software for shipboard and shore-based operations. These engineers must meet specific security clearance requirements and often need to be familiar with Department of Defense (DoD) standards and protocols. Their contributions are critical to ensuring the reliability and security of Navy technology.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a contract Navy software engineer?

To thrive as a Contract Navy Software Engineer, you need expertise in software development, systems engineering, and a solid understanding of defense or military protocols, with at least a bachelor's deg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with secure coding practices, DoD-approved development environments, and certifications such as Security+ or CISSP are typically required.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ective communication skills are crucial for collaborating on complex, mission-critical projects. These skills and qualifications ensure that software solutions are reliable, secure, and meet stringent Navy operational requirements.
